Ingredient Breakdown – What Makes It Effective
Vitamin C (3-O-Ethyl Ascorbic Acid): A stabilized form of Vitamin C that helps brighten skin and reduce pigmentation.
Vitamin E: Protects the skin from oxidative damage while aiding in moisture retention.
Niacinamide: Helps reduce redness, regulate oil, and improve skin texture.
Zinc Oxide + Organic Filters: Broad-spectrum sun protection without clogging pores or causing white cast.
Blue Light Actives: Added ingredients designed to combat light from screens—an increasingly common skin aggressor.
All ingredients are dermatologically tested and free of parabens, sulfates, and mineral oil.
This blend supports skin health while ensuring maximum protection—something rare in typical sunscreens.

How to Apply for Best Results
Cleanse Your Face: Start with a fresh base
Use Moisturizer (if needed): Especially for dry or sensitive skin
Apply Sunscreen Generously: Use two fingers' worth for face and neck
Pat Instead of Rubbing: Helps with even absorption
Reapply Every 2–3 Hours: Especially if outdoors or exposed to sunlight for long
For makeup users, apply sunscreen as the final step in skincare and before primer/foundation.
For non-makeup days, it works well solo without feeling heavy.
Reapplication is key, especially if sweating or exposed to screens or sun.

How It Helps with Blue Light Protection
Phones, laptops, and LED lights emit blue light, which contributes to pigmentation, dullness, and early aging.
DOT & KEY sunscreen contains blue light filters that act like a protective layer against this invisible damage.
